I think that 1 3/4" is a lot of bare slip yolk. I was told that they need 3/4" min-1" max travel.....slide the slip yolk into the trans till it bottoms,then mark it...pull it out 7/8",& measure center to center of the u joints from there. This info came from a driveline shop that has done several shafts for me. due to the differences in slip yolks(as to where the spline starts on the inside)measurements will vary,& its hard to get the proper depth by measuring the outside.
